Mayflower Next for Philbrick

by John F. Baker -- Publishers Weekly, 3/18/2002

Nathaniel Philbrick (In the Heart of the Sea) has become a significant maritime historian, and has taken as his next subject nothing less than the voyage of the Mayflower and the Pilgrims' landing at Plymouth Rock--a thrice-told tale, but one he feels he can bring to new life by his research. Viking's Wendy Wolf bought the untitled project from agent Stuart Krichevsky, for North American rights only, but publication is four years away; the author is still working on his next book.
